Stiffened Buckram for Bookbinding from Canada

Linen-based buckram stiffened with gum coating for use in creating rigid covers for deluxe book editions. Classified under HTS 5901.90.40.00 for textile fabrics coated with gum used for outer book covers. Provides archival strength and aesthetic appeal for library binding.

Import Tips

Specify bookbinding grade and coating type in commercial invoices

Avoid over-stiffening that could resemble Chapter 39 plastic products

Use proper HTS for library/archival vs. decorative craft applications
